在数字化转型的浪潮中,企业正在寻求更高效的方式来管理和利用数据。知识库构建技术作为一种重要的数据管理手段,正在帮助企业实现数据的结构化、语义化和智能化应用。本文将深入探讨基于语义理解的知识库构建技术,分析其实现方法及其对企业数据中台、数字孪生和数字可视化等领域的应用价值。
知识库(Knowledge Base)是一种结构化的数据集合,用于存储和管理特定领域内的实体及其关系。与传统的数据库不同,知识库更注重语义理解和关联性,能够以更智能化的方式支持复杂的查询和分析任务。
基于语义理解的知识库构建技术,通过自然语言处理(NLP)和机器学习等技术,从非结构化文本中提取实体、关系和属性,并将其转化为结构化的知识表示。这种技术能够显著提升知识库构建的效率和准确性,为企业提供更强大的数据支持。
知识库构建的第一步是数据采集。数据来源可以是多种多样的,包括文本数据(如文档、网页)、结构化数据(如表格、数据库)以及多模态数据(如图像、视频)。对于企业用户来说,常见的数据来源包括:
数据预处理是构建知识库的关键步骤之一。通过对原始数据进行清洗、分词和标准化处理,可以为后续的信息抽取和语义理解提供高质量的基础数据。
信息抽取是从数据中提取实体、关系和属性的过程。基于语义理解的信息抽取技术,能够从非结构化文本中自动识别关键信息,并将其转化为结构化的形式。
语义理解是基于语义分析技术,对文本内容进行深度解析,提取其隐含的信息和意图。通过语义理解,可以更准确地构建知识库,避免信息抽取中的歧义和错误。
知识建模是将提取的信息转化为结构化的知识表示的过程。常见的知识建模方法包括:
知识整合是将多个来源的知识进行融合,消除冲突并保持一致性。例如,从不同文档中提取的同一实体可能有不同的属性值,需要通过知识整合技术统一这些信息。
预训练语言模型(如BERT、GPT-3)在语义理解任务中表现出色。通过利用这些模型,可以显著提升信息抽取和语义理解的准确性和效率。
知识库构建通常涉及大量的数据处理和计算任务。通过分布式计算技术(如MapReduce、Spark),可以显著提升处理效率,降低成本。
自动化工具可以帮助企业快速构建和管理知识库。例如,使用自动化爬虫工具采集数据,使用自动化标注工具进行数据标注。
知识库可以用于企业内部信息的管理和共享,例如员工信息、产品信息、客户信息等。通过知识库,企业可以快速查询和更新信息,提升管理效率。
基于知识库的智能问答系统,能够通过语义理解技术,准确回答用户的问题。例如,用户可以通过问答系统查询某个产品的功能或某个事件的背景信息。
知识库可以用于推荐系统的构建,例如基于用户的兴趣和行为,推荐相关的商品或内容。通过知识库,推荐系统可以更准确地理解用户需求,提升推荐效果。
未来的知识库将更加注重多模态数据的融合,例如文本、图像、视频等多种数据类型的结合。通过多模态知识库,可以更全面地理解和表示现实世界。
随着人工智能技术的发展,知识库的构建将更加自动化。例如,通过自动化标注工具和预训练模型,可以显著降低知识库构建的人力成本。
知识库的可解释性是其应用的重要前提。未来的知识库构建技术将更加注重可解释性,例如通过可视化技术,帮助用户理解知识库的构建过程和结果。
知识库构建技术作为一种重要的数据管理手段,正在帮助企业实现数据的结构化、语义化和智能化应用。通过基于语义理解的高效实现方法,企业可以更快速、更准确地构建知识库,提升数据管理和应用能力。
如果您对知识库构建技术感兴趣,或者希望了解更详细的应用案例,欢迎申请试用我们的解决方案:申请试用。
申请试用&下载资料